Output 676843dbd7e08845d785b1184e029804db110275337a7e80b0fc996aee9f51e0:1

value
742221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c63d2b994b11bc77ca0822d25c6f83918c890844 OP_EQUAL
address
3KmCziM4D1YD9T6FfrX33FuEoSYm5tjCh8
transaction
676843dbd7e08845d785b1184e029804db110275337a7e80b0fc996aee9f51e0
spent
true